From 687a2df255eac4e275d49c0bc270064f88a43cd3 Mon Sep 17 00:00:00 2001 From: Aliaksej Mialeshka Date: Wed, 28 May 2025 19:59:42 +0200 Subject: [PATCH 1/2] Update Selenium to 4.33.0 +semver:feature --- pom.xml |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/pom.xml b/pom.xml index 2e4c9ba..e1b8435 100644 --- a/pom.xml +++ b/pom.xml @@ -121,7 +121,7 @@ com.google.guava guava - 33.4.0-jre + 33.4.8-jre com.fasterxml.jackson.core @@ -131,7 +131,7 @@ org.seleniumhq.selenium selenium-java - 4.28.1 + 4.33.0 io.appium From 93a8b72eb28a736c2570eeead928f91d897ead2b Mon Sep 17 00:00:00 2001 From: Aliaksej Mialeshka Date: Wed, 28 May 2025 20:13:33 +0200 Subject: [PATCH 2/2] fix setting of implicit wait --- .../java/tests/applications/windowsApp/WindowsApplication.java |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/src/test/java/tests/applications/windowsApp/WindowsApplication.java b/src/test/java/tests/applications/windowsApp/WindowsApplication.java index e87e29c..a3d9321 100644 --- a/src/test/java/tests/applications/windowsApp/WindowsApplication.java +++ b/src/test/java/tests/applications/windowsApp/WindowsApplication.java @@ -7,7 +7,6 @@ import java.net.URL; import java.time.Duration; -import java.util.concurrent.TimeUnit; public class WindowsApplication implements IApplication { private long implicitWaitSeconds; @@ -34,7 +33,7 @@ public boolean isStarted() { public void setImplicitWaitTimeout(Duration value) { long valueInSeconds = value.getSeconds(); if (implicitWaitSeconds != valueInSeconds){ - driver.manage().timeouts().implicitlyWait(value.toMillis(), TimeUnit.MILLISECONDS); + driver.manage().timeouts().implicitlyWait(value); implicitWaitSeconds = valueInSeconds; } }